数组元素在java中导致]预期错误

数组元素在java中导致]预期错误,java,compiler-errors,identifier,Java,Compiler Errors,Identifier,我正在我的CIS-162类中积极处理一个需要多个数组的项目,但是每当我尝试编译时,数组中的每个元素都会遇到一个]预期错误。我做错了什么 我已经在多个平台上搜索了答案,并尝试将我的数组格式设置为与它们的格式完全相同,但没有结果 private boolean[] bet = new boolean[9]; bet[0] = false; bet[1] = false; ... bet[8] = false; 我应该有一个1×9的布尔表达式数组,不是吗?如果你在ma

我正在我的CIS-162类中积极处理一个需要多个数组的项目,但是每当我尝试编译时,数组中的每个元素都会遇到一个]预期错误。我做错了什么

我已经在多个平台上搜索了答案,并尝试将我的数组格式设置为与它们的格式完全相同,但没有结果

private boolean[] bet = new boolean[9];
    bet[0] = false;
    bet[1] = false;
    ...
    bet[8] = false;

我应该有一个1×9的布尔表达式数组,不是吗?

如果你在main_类中,你不应该使用private。。。。;
直接使用布尔值[]bet=..

是否在方法内部赋值?我支持Maroun的问题。听起来你想在花括号之外做这件事{}我是作为一个实例变量赋值的我在一个单独的类中,目前没有main方法。在创建时给表值如下:private boolean[]bet=new boolean[]{true,false….};或者在构造函数和方法中。